My understanding is that this camp will be used to determine the USA team's roster for the IIHF World Championship which will take place in April. The Olympic team will have a separate tryout process and will likely include many or all of the chosen IIHF players plus select others including college players who will be "centralized" for a months-long tryout process. So it's still possible that Hannah Brandt (and others who were not named for the upcoming IIHF Worlds) will get an Olympic Team tryout later on. I see that Hannah Brandt was just selected as one of the Top 10 finalists for the Patty Kazmaier Award:
2013 Patty Kazmaier Award Top 10 Finalists
Player's Name ... Position ....Class ... School
Megan Bozek ...........D ...........Sr. ....Minnesota
Hannah Brandt ........F ............Fr. ....Minnesota
Alex Carpenter ........F ...........So. ....Boston College
Kendall Coyne .........F ...........So. ....Northeastern
Brianna Decker ........F ...........Sr. ....Wisconsin
Jillian Dempsey ........F ...........Sr. ....Harvard
Brianne Jenner ........F ............Jr. ....Cornell
Amanda Kessel ........F ...........Jr.......Minnesota
Jocelyne Lamoureux .F ...........Sr. ....North Dakota
Noora Raty ............G ............Sr......Minnesota
